The Forgotten Orphanage​

The Forgotten Orphanage is a very old building. As it name states, it used to be an orphanage, but after a nuclear disaster several years ago, it had been abandoned by the population; people were afraid the spirits of the dead children would haunt the place. Since humans cleared the whole area, baby Pokémon started to show up, playing with the long forgotten toys of the Orphanage. Since the Forgotten Orphanage is a very old building, it is separated in areas, each having different inhabitants.

Most of the Pokémon here are eager for adventure, so you should not have problems catching some. You start the game with Six Poké Balls. If you wish for additional Poké Balls, you will be charged at the rate of 1$ /2 Poké Balls. If you wish to change area during your challenge, state it. It won’t cost anything. The prices are: 1$ for common (75% chance), 2$ for uncommon (20% chance) and 4$ for rare (5% chance). You have a 1/200 chance of finding a shiny, and it will cost the same as if it wasn’t. Some Pokémon can hold items. If it does, you will be warned – you can decide to keep the item but not the Pokémon for 1$, or catch the Pokémon and keep the item for free.

If you fail to respond for two weeks without me knowing, your challenge will end and your Pokémon released.
